Understanding Natural Gas Heating Systems

Natural gas heating systems use natural gas, a clean-burning fossil fuel, to generate heat for residential spaces. These systems convert natural gas into thermal energy, which is then distributed throughout the home via ducts, radiators, or underfloor heating.

Types of Natural Gas Heating Systems

1. Furnaces

Natural gas furnaces are one of the most common heating systems. They work by burning natural gas to heat air, which is then distributed through ductwork.

  • Pros: High energy efficiency, rapid heating, compatibility with existing ductwork.
  • Cons: Requires regular maintenance and filter replacement.

2. Boilers

Natural gas boilers heat water to generate steam or hot water, which is circulated through radiators or underfloor pipes.

  • Pros: Even heat distribution, quieter operation, suitable for radiant floor heating.
  • Cons: Higher installation costs, slower initial heating.

3. Space Heaters

These compact units are ideal for heating small areas. They’re a convenient option for supplemental heating in specific rooms.

  • Pros: Portable, easy to install, cost-effective for small spaces.
  • Cons: Limited coverage, not suitable for whole-home heating.

4. Fireplaces

Natural gas fireplaces combine aesthetic appeal with functional heating. They are often used as supplemental heating sources.

  • Pros: Stylish, zone heating capabilities, easy ignition.
  • Cons: Lower efficiency compared to furnaces and boilers.

Key Considerations Before Installation

  1. Availability Ensure that natural gas is available in your area. Homes located near existing natural gas pipelines are more likely to benefit from this energy source.
  2. Initial Costs While natural gas systems are cost-effective in the long run, the initial installation costs can be significant, especially if you need to install new ductwork or gas lines.
  3. Safety Measures Install carbon monoxide detectors and ensure regular maintenance to prevent potential hazards.
  4. Energy Efficiency Ratings Look for systems with high Annual Fuel Utilization Efficiency (AFUE) ratings to maximize energy savings.

Maintenance Tips for Optimal Performance

  1. Regular Inspections Schedule annual inspections by a qualified technician to identify and address issues early.
  2. Filter Replacement Replace furnace filters every 1-3 months to maintain efficient airflow and indoor air quality.
  3. Duct Cleaning Clean ducts regularly to prevent blockages and improve heat distribution.
  4. Monitor Gas Lines Ensure gas lines are inspected for leaks or damage to ensure safe and efficient operation.

Future of Natural Gas Heating

With advancements in technology, natural gas heating systems are becoming even more efficient and environmentally friendly. Innovations such as condensing boilers and smart thermostats are reducing energy consumption and enhancing user convenience. Additionally, the integration of renewable natural gas (RNG) derived from organic waste offers a sustainable alternative to traditional natural gas.
